什么是程序.

什么是程序.
在口常生活中,我们也经常会川到.’程序”这个词,如..评审程序”、“工作程序”等,这里1
序的意思是一做事情的工作步骤”,计算机中的程序也是指安排计算机工作的步骤.程序.
(Program)是指山人根据某一特定的需要而编写的控制计算机工作的有限命令序列,是对所
要解决问题的各个对象和处理规则的描述。
从本质上讲,能正常工作的计算机是一台能高速执行程序的机器,它由处理器、存储器
以及愉人输出设备组成,其中处理器用于执行程序,程序和执行程序所需的数据保存在存储
器中,输人设备用于将需要处理的外部世界的数据传递给计算机。而输出设备则将处理的结
果信息传递给外部世界.没有程序的计算机,不能做任何事情,即便是最简单的操作也不会
做。计算机解决问题的4本过程是这样的:首先把能解决问题的程序存人计算机.然后由计
算机执行该程序,输入解决该问题必要的数据,计算机按照程序规定的步骤进行处理,最后
输出结果。计算机网络出现后,多台计算机可以协同工作,来解决同一个问题,相应地,为了
解决一个问题,需要多个程序一起工作才能达到目的。例如,我们要从Internet上下载一
泞歌曲,则需要如下步骤:
[url=http://www.gzshangxin.com/]保安服装批发[/url]在一台Internet服务器上安装下载服务程序,如FTP Server:在用户工作计算机
上装上下载客户端程序,如浏览器:
(2)启动下载服务程序:在工作计算机上启动浏览器:
(3)输人关于所需下载的歌曲及地址信息:
(4)下载服务程序找到该歌曲,经过网络发送到工作计算机:
(5)川户工作计算机接收到该歌曲.
如果需要播放该歌曲.则需要启动另外一个专门的歌曲播放程序,按照相同的步骤来工
作。通常,为了解决不同的问题。就需要编写不同的程序.程序种类繁多.有些通用(例如,
文字处理程序),有些专用(例如,企业的生产过程控制程序):运行和开发这些程序的环境可
以是PC机,也可以是网络。但不管怎样变化多端,任何应用总是离不开程序,离不开程序
设计。
与程序相关的另外一个概念是软件,软件相当于“程序+文档”,是程序上升为独立产品
后的产物。例如,我们通常称购买来的杀毒程序为“杀毒软件”,因为购买的除了杀毒程序
外,还有相关的操作说明书、技术资料和病毒特征数据.
那么,计算机程序是怎么得到的呢?首先,要知道程序要做什么((What to do?),在此葵础
上考虑怎么做(How to do?),然后根据考虑结果开始编写程序‘Do it. ),最后是编译和运行
程序。图1一1表示了计算机解决问题的过程。
图l一计算机解决问肠的过程
你也可以看看http://www.gzshangxin.com这个是用什么程序做的哦!!
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值